House Wrecking in Beaumont, TX
House wrecking services involve the careful dismantling and removal of entire structures, typically residential buildings, to prepare a property for redevelopment or renovation. These projects can include demolishing an outdated or unsafe home, clearing a site for new construction, or removing structures that are no longer suitable for occupancy. Homeowners interested in this service should consider the scope of the wrecking, the size and type of the building, and any local regulations or permits required before beginning the process.
Property owners often seek house wrecking services to safely and efficiently clear a property while minimizing damage to surrounding areas. It’s important to understand the extent of demolition needed, including whether interior stripping or complete teardown is required, and to inquire about debris removal and site cleanup. Clarifying these details beforehand can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s redevelopment plans and adheres to local guidelines.

Common House Wrecking Jobs
House Demolition - complete removal of residential structures to prepare for new construction or renovations.
Interior Wrecking - removal of interior walls, fixtures, and finishes to update or remodel living spaces.
Selective Demolition - targeted tearing down of specific areas or features to preserve parts of the home.
Foundation Demolition - safe removal of old or damaged foundations to enable rebuilding or repair.
Garage and Shed Removal - tearing down detached structures to free up yard space or for property upgrades.
Asbestos and Hazardous Material Removal - careful demolition that includes safe handling and disposal of hazardous substances.
House Wrecking Questions
What types of structures can be demolished? House wrecking services typically handle residential homes, garages, sheds, and small commercial buildings.
Is the process safe for surrounding properties? Proper planning and safety measures ensure nearby structures and landscapes are protected during demolition.
What should be prepared before wrecking begins? Clear the area of personal belongings and obstacles to facilitate a smooth demolition process.
What happens to debris after wrecking? Debris is usually sorted and removed from the site, with recyclable materials separated when possible.
